Lieutenant Joseph Turner is a character that appears in Call of Duty: WWII. He provides ammunition for the player and is a father to his men, often in battle with William Pierson, who is an antagonist to the squad.

Who killed Turner in cod ww2?
Daniels pulls him back to one of the trenches but Turner tells him and his squad to fall back so that he can give them covering fire. He barely and desperately stands up and fires his Thompson but he’s shot to death by another German soldier, lying lifelessly with his eyes open.

How do you save Fischer in WW2?
Head downstairs but wait for the two soldiers on patrol to leave the area. In the room at the bottom of the staircase, you’ll find Fischer being interrogated. Quickly and quietly sneak into the room and save him. By the time you’re done, there should be a soldier in the staircase you just came from – take him out too.

Turner, in full Joseph Mallord William Turner, (born April 23, 1775, London, England—died December 19, 1851, London), English Romantic landscape painter whose expressionistic studies of light, colour, and atmosphere were unmatched in their range and sublimity. Turner was the son of a barber. At age 10 he was sent to live with an uncle at Brentford, Middlesex, where he attended school.

William George Turner was born Feb. 5, 1919 to H. Lafayette and Jessie Blanche Thackery Turner. He died Dec. 12, 1941 and is buried in National Memorial Cemetery of the Pacific, Honolulu, Hawaii. Pvt. Turner served in World War II with the U.S. Marine Corps and died from wounds received on Dec. 7, 1941 in the Japanese attack on Pearl Harbor.

Turner SMLE | Gun Wiki | Fandom
The Turner SMLE was a prototype American semi-automatic conversion for the Lee-Enfield. Russell Turner, a private gunsmith based in Pennsylvania, developed this rifle in 1941 for the Canadian Army on seeing the potential of these sorts of weapons. He then submitted it to the Canadian Army, where it was tested against the M1 Garand. The weapon was put through a number of different tests …
